[QUOTE="Munyaradzi Mafaro, post: 78937, member: 636"] The national lawyers' group is begging Uganda's top judges to finally rule on an old case, keeping a man in prison. The Uganda Law Society sent a letter to the Supreme Court about the five-year-old appeal involving the Attorney General and former accountant Geoffrey Kazinda. They say the delay means Kazinda stays locked up illegally at Luzira prison, a situation that began over a decade ago. The society is worried Chief Justice Alfonse Owiny Dollo, who led the hearing, will retire in roughly a month without giving a verdict. They fear his departure could cause even longer delays if a new judicial panel must be formed. Kazinda was originally convicted on fraud charges, but those rulings were tossed out by lower appeals courts years ago. A constitutional court even ordered his release back in 2020, a decision the state blocked by appealing to the Supreme Court. That high court appeal was first argued in 2021 and heard again last year after some judges changed. There has still been no final judgment. The legal group says Kazinda is still in custody only because the Supreme Court has not made its decision, despite previous courts clearing him. [/QUOTE]
